KIM PERCY - Highly Commended

Working across painting photography, digital imagine augmented reality, video, installation and sculpture. Kim Percy explores themes of social change, such as the impact of climate change on the environment, concerns about forced population migration, and the experience of motherhood. Shot at night on a beach in Thailand, Future Vision, features a woman playing on a swing, yet the image's blurred, highly saturated treatment gives it a dreamlike appeal.

"The best camera is the camera in your hand," says Percy, "and often, that is a smartphone. The quality of the technology adds an eeriness to the photo, which I would not have achieved with a high-end DSUR camera."

The ebb and flow of the emotional toll of daily decision-making is captured in this image as the swing is caught in a state of anxious stasis above an encroaching ocean tide.

"The figure gazing into the dark skies offers a sense of foreboding and despair while the swing is a gentle reflection of childhood memories, remarks judge Brett Mickan. "

The soft focus and clever use of restraint, allows for quiet reflection as the artist offers you a glimpse into her journey."
